· Identification number(s): · EC number: 238-878-4 SECTION 4: First aid measures · 4.1 Description of first aid measures · General information Personal protection for the First Aider. · After inhalation Supply fresh air; consult doctor in case of symptoms. · After skin contact Rinse with large amount of water and soap. · After eye contact Rinse opened eye for several minutes under running water. · After swallowing In case of persistent symptoms consult doctor. · 4.2 Most important symptoms and effects, both acute and delayed No further relevant information available. · 4.3 Indication of any immediate medical attention and special treatment needed No further relevant information available. SECTION 5: Firefighting measures · 5.1 Extinguishing media · Suitable extinguishing agents Use fire fighting measures that suit the environment. · 5.2 Special hazards arising from the substance or mixture No further relevant information available. · 5.3 Advice for firefighters · Protective equipment: Wear self-contained breathing apparatus. SECTION 6: Accidental release measures · 6.1 Personal precautions, protective equipment and emergency procedures Wear protective equipment. Keep unprotected persons away. · 6.2 Environmental precautions: Do not allow product to reach sewage system or water bodies. · 6.3 Methods and material for containment and cleaning up: Pick up the product mechanically, avoid dust formation. · 6.4 Reference to other sections No dangerous materials are released. See Section 7 for information on safe handling See Section 8 for information on personal protection equipment. See Section 13 for information on disposal. SECTION 7: Handling and storage · 7.1 Precautions for safe handling Keep away from children. Prevent formation of dust. Ensure good ventilation/exhaustion at the workplace. · Information about protection against explosions and fires: No special measures required. · 7.2 Conditions for safe storage, including any incompatibilities · Storage · Requirements to be met by storerooms and containers: No special requirements. · Information about storage in one common storage facility: Please follow the rules of the VCI-Storage-Concept for chemicals. · Further information about storage conditions: None. · 7.3 Specific end use(s) No further relevant information available. SECTION 8: Exposure controls/personal protection · Additional information about design of technical systems: Eye-wash bottle must be available. It must be possible to wash the skin in the working area. · 8.1 Control parameters · Components with critical values that require monitoring at the workplace: Not required. · Additional information: The lists that were valid during the compilation were used as basis. · 8.2 Exposure controls · Personal protective equipment · General protective and hygienic measures The usual precautionary measures should be adhered to in handling the chemicals. Do not inhale dust / smoke / mist. Avoid contact with the eyes and skin. · Breathing equipment: Not required. · Protection of hands: Hand Protection: Nitril-rubber-latex-gloves. · Material of gloves Butyl rubber II R: Thickness ≥ 0,5mm; Break through time ≥ 480 min · Penetration time of glove material The exact break trough time has to be found out by the manufacturer of the protective gloves and has to be observed. · Eye protection: Safety glasses · Body protection: Protective work clothing.
